OpenAGI vs MetaGPT: Millise AI Agendi Raamistikuga peaksid sa 2025. aastal ehitama?
Õige AI agendi raamistiku valimine 2025. aastal ei ole ainult tehniline otsus – see on toote strateegia. Vale valik võib sind sulgeda rabedasse arhitektuuri, paisutada järelduskulusid või piirata reaalse maailma integratsioone. Õige valik kiirendab sind prototüübist tootmisse koos sisseehitatud mitme agendi orkestreerimise, tööriistade, mälu ja hindamisega.
Selles praktilises, lahendustele orienteeritud analüüsis võrdleme OpenAGI-d ja MetaGPT-d – kahte nime, mida arendajad agentide raamistikke uurides regulaarselt kohtavad. Me analüüsime arhitektuuri, orkestreerimist, tööriistu, mälu, koostöömudeleid, juurutusmudeleid ja kompromisse, mis on olulised, kui ehitate agentseid süsteeme reaalseid kasutajaid silmas pidades.
Muide, kui uurite mitme agendi töövooge teadustöö, kodeerimisabiliste või klienditoe jaoks, tasub märkida, kuidas laiem agentne ökosüsteem 2025. aastal areneb: tööriistad, mälud ja planeerimine on enesestmõistetavad; platvorme eristab nüüd usaldusväärsus, jälgitavus, integratsiooni ulatus ja meeskonnatöö, kusjuures arendajakesksed agentide ehitajad on esile kerkimas eraldi kategooriana.
- OpenAGI: Parim, kui soovid modulaarset, tööriistakeskset, teadussõbralikku agendi raamistikku, mida saad sügavalt kohandada. Tugev prototüüpimiseks, komponeeritavuseks ja eksperimentaalseteks agentide torujuhtmeteks.
- MetaGPT: Parim, kui soovid valmis mitme agendiga "agentide ettevõtte" mudeleid tarkvaratehnika, tooteideede ja projektistiilis töövoogude jaoks. Tugevad vaikesätted koostööks ja rollispetsialiseerumiseks.
Põhiküsimus: Mida sa tegelikult ehitad?
Enne funktsioonide võrdlemist keskendu oma kasutusjuhtumile:
- Sa vajad konfigureeritavat agendi selgroogu, et siduda tööriistu, mälu ja hindajaid? OpenAGI modulaarsus tundub tõenäoliselt loomulik.
- Sa soovid AI "meeskonda", mis suudab ideid genereerida, planeerida, kodeerida ja üle vaadata rollipõhiste agentidega? MetaGPT "agentide ettevõtte" plaan kiirendab sind.
Arhitektuur ja filosoofia
- OpenAGI: Rõhutab komponeeritavaid komponente – planeerija, tööriista suunaja, mälu, otsija ja täitja. Julgustab sind paindlikult kokku õmblema arutlusahelaid, tööriistade kasutamist ja väliseid API-sid. Suurepärane kohandatud torujuhtmete ja teadusstiilis iteratsiooni jaoks.
- MetaGPT: Emuleerib organisatsiooni. Sa määratled rollid (tootejuht, arhitekt, insener, kvaliteedi tagaja) ja raamistik orkestreerib koostööd, üleandmisi ja kvaliteedikontrolli. Suurepärane tarkvara loomiseks või projektilaadseteks protsessideks, kus mitme agendi spetsialiseerumine on oluline.
Miks see on oluline: Agentne AI on liikunud reaktiivsetelt viipadelt proaktiivsetele, tööriistu kasutavatele süsteemidele, millel on planeerimine ja tagasisideahelad. Kui soovid lõuendit, vali OpenAGI; kui soovid mänguraamatut, vali MetaGPT.
Orkestreerimine ja planeerimine
- OpenAGI: Tavaliselt annab sulle detailse kontrolli planeerimise üle (üksik-/mitmeastmeline), koos konksudega planeerijate ja hindajate vahetamiseks. Sa saad luua tahtlikke arutluskäike, tööriistakõnesid ja eneserefleksiooni.
- MetaGPT: Planeerimine on rollipõhine. Tootejuht "planeerib", arhitekt "kujundab", insener "rakendab", kvaliteedi tagaja "testib". Meta-orkestreerimine on planeerimine. Sa kohandad rolle, malle ja ülevaatuste teid.
Arendaja järeldus: Kui sulle meeldib planeerija ja suunamisloogika peenhäälestamine, sobib OpenAGI. Kui eelistad eelnevalt ehitatud koostöödünaamikat, võidab MetaGPT.
Tööriistad, integratsioonid ja API-d
Agentne baasjoon 2025. aastal hõlmab tööriistakõnesid, API-ühendusi ja pikaajalist mälu.
- OpenAGI: Sageli eksponeerib tööriistaregistrit lihtsate skeemidega, et saaksid lisada REST/GraphQL, vektorotsingu, faili I/O ja struktureeritud väljundeid. Hea kohandatud infrastruktuuri integreerimiseks, alates otsingust kuni sisemiste süsteemideni.
- MetaGPT: Tarnitakse rollispetsiifiliste tööriistakettide ja mudelitega (nt spetsifikatsioonide kirjutamine, hoidla tellingud, koodi genereerimine, koodi ülevaatus, testid). Sa saad endiselt tööriistu lisada, kuid vaikimisi tööriistakomplekt on tarkvara töövoogude jaoks arvamusel baseeruv.
Mälu ja teadmised
- OpenAGI: Mälu on ühendatav – vaheta manuseid, vektorpoode või RAG-lähenemisi ilma oma agenti ümber kirjutamata. Kui sa vajad kasutajapõhist mälu, meeskonnamälu või episoodilist vs semantilist mälu, saad seda selgesõnaliselt modelleerida.
- MetaGPT: Mälu kipub olema seotud rolli töövoogudega – nõuded, disainimärkmed, koodi artefaktid, PR-i kommentaarid. See toimib hästi insenerikesksete elutsüklite jaoks, vähem rõhku pannakse meelevaldsetele mälutopoloogiatele.
Koostöö ja mitme agendi mudelid
- OpenAGI: Toetab mitme agendi seadistusi, kuid sa komponeerid mudeleid ise – arutelu, kriitika, suunamine, komitee hääletamine või juhendaja-töötaja mudelid.
- MetaGPT: Koostöö on toode. See küpsetab sisse üleandmised, ülevaatused ja artefaktid. Kui sa soovid kiiresti "virtuaalset tarkvarafirmat", pakub MetaGPT kiirust ja piirdeid.
Usaldusväärsus, hindamine ja jälgitavus
Kogu ökosüsteemis nõuavad ehitajad üha enam hindamisrakmeid, jälgi ja käitusloge.
- OpenAGI: Lihtsam on sisse panna oma hinnanguid (üksuse testid viipade jaoks, tööriistade kasutamise täpsus, mõttekäigu puhverserverid) ja jälgitavust (jälitus, žetoonide arvestus). Ideaalne teadusuuringute ja tootmise tugevdamiseks.
- MetaGPT: Saavutab usaldusväärsuse protsessi kaudu – spetsifikatsioonid, ülevaatused, kvaliteedikontroll. Sa soovid endiselt telemeetriat, kuid kvaliteet tuleneb rollipõhisest üleküllusest ja etappidest väljunditest.
Toimivus ja kulude kontroll
- OpenAGI: Kuna sa kontrollid planeerijaid, tööriistu ja vahemällu salvestamist, saad agressiivselt optimeerida – partii allalaadimist, valikulist tööriista kutsumist ja mudeli vahetamist sammu kohta.
- MetaGPT: Rohkem sõnumeid ja üleandmisi võib tähendada suuremat žetoonide kasutamist, kuid sa saad rolle kärpida, konteksti tihendada ja artefakte vahemällu salvestada. Tasu on parem struktuur ja vähem loogikavigu keeruka tarkvara ehitamisel.
Juurutamine ja operatsioonid
- OpenAGI: Paindlik kohapeal, VPC-s või hübriidselt – eriti kui sa pead andmeid hoidma rangetes piirides. Hea, kui sa pead ühendama olemasolevatesse MLOpsi virnadesse.
- MetaGPT: Sobib sageli hästi pilvearenduse töövoogudega (hoidlad, CI/CD, PR-id). Kui su väljund on kood hoidlas, tunduvad MetaGPT arvamusel baseeruvad vaikesätted loomulikud.
Kogukond ja ökosüsteem
- OpenAGI: Meelitab ligi nokitsejaid ja teadlasi, kes jagavad planeerijaid, tööriistu ja hindamisstrateegiaid. Oota mitmekesiseid näiteid, alates andmeagentidest kuni tugirobotiteni.
- MetaGPT: Elav ehitajate seas, kes vajavad tarkvara tarnimist: toote spetsifikatsioonid, arhitektuuridokumendid, koodi genereerimine ja kvaliteedikontrolli torujuhtmed. Mallid ja rollipakid on pluss.
Kasutusjuhtumid: Mida kumbki kõige paremini teeb
- OpenAGI paistab silma järgmisega:
- Teadusassistendid kohandatud RAG-iga
- Tugiteenuste triaažiagendid, kes suunavad ja tegutsevad API-de kaudu
- Andmete töötlemise ja analüütika kaasjuhid
- Kohandatud hindajad ja ohutuskihtid
- MetaGPT paistab silma järgmisega:
- Tooteideed → PRD → arhitektuur → hoidla tellingud
- Mitme faili koodi genereerimine ja refaktooring
- QA/testimistsüklid ja dokumentatsioon
- Meeskonnalaadne koostöö ja ülevaatusvood
Plussid ja miinused lühidalt
- Plussid: Väga modulaarne, tööriistakeskne, teadussõbralik, lihtne paigutada eritellimusel valmistatud virnadesse, peeneteraline kulude kontroll.
- Miinused: Vaja rohkem kokkupanekut, vähem valmis meeskonnamudeleid, järsem õppimiskõver tootmise töövoogude jaoks.
- Plussid: Valmis agentide ettevõte, tugevad vaikesätted tarkvaraarenduse jaoks, kiirem tee töötavate hoidlate ja dokumentideni, kvaliteet protsessi kaudu.
- Miinused: Arvamusel baseeruv; mitte-inseneritöö vood võivad tunduda sunnitud, rohkem üldkulusid ülesande kohta, kohandamine võib olla vaikesätetest kaugemal keerulisem.
Valimine eesmärgiga: Otsustusmaatriks
Esita need viis küsimust:
- Kas sa vajad rollipõhist koostööd kohe karbist välja? Kui jah → MetaGPT.
- Kas sa vajad sügavat kontrolli planeerijate, mälu ja tööriistade üle? Kui jah → OpenAGI.
- Kas sinu väljund on peamiselt kood ja dokumendid hoidlas? Kui jah → MetaGPT.
- Kas sa vajad ranget kohapealset kohandamist ja jälgitavust? Kui jah → OpenAGI.
- Kas sa optimeerid kiirust-väärtust vs pikaajalist paindlikkust? Kiirus → MetaGPT; Paindlikkus → OpenAGI.
Reaalse maailma ehitusmudelid
- Klienditoe suunaja (OpenAGI): Sisesta piletid, kasuta RAG-i poliitikadokumentide kaudu, helista välistele API-dele arvelduse või pakkumise lahendamiseks, eskaleeri struktureeritud kokkuvõtetega.
- Greenfieldi rakenduse generaator (MetaGPT): PM koostab PRD, arhitekt genereerib kõrgetasemelise disaini, insener ehitab hoidla tellingud ja rakendab põhifunktsioonid, QA kirjutab testid ja aruanded.
- Andmete vastavuse agent (OpenAGI): Tööriista käivitamist piirab poliitikamootor, käitab päringuid, logib muutumatuid jälgi ja koostab auditi jaoks valmis kokkuvõtteid.
- Refaktooringu sprindi bot (MetaGPT): Loeb hoidlat, avab probleeme, pakub välja refaktooringuid, esitab PR-e ja taotleb QA valideerimist.
Mida turg 2025. aastal premeerib
Tööstuse konsensus koondub agentide süsteemide ümber, millel on:
- Proaktiivne planeerimine ja tööriista täitmine
- Pikaajaline mälu ja taaskasutatavad teadmised
- Integratsioonid reaalse maailma API-de ja andmetega
Rakendamise näpunäited ja lõksud
- Alusta kitsalt: Määra üks edukuse mõõdik (nt PR ühendatud, pilet lahendatud) ja korda.
- Instrumenteerige varakult: Logige tööriistakõned, edukuse/ebaõnnestumise määrad ja žetoonide kasutamine sammu kohta.
- Lisa piirded: Kasuta struktureeritud väljundeid, valideerijaid ja poliitikakontrolle enne kõrvaltoimeid põhjustavaid tegevusi.
- Vahemällu agressiivselt: Taaskasuta allalaadimise tulemusi ja tihenda kontekste.
- Inimene-silmus: Lisa riskantsete tegevuste ja koodi ühendamiste jaoks kinnitamisväravad.
Tasub märkida: Käepärane abiline iteratsiooniks
Kui sa genereerid ideid, koostad spetsifikatsioone või dokumenteerid mitme agendi vooge enne koodi ühendamist, võib tööruumi assistent iteratsiooni kiirendada. Tasub märkida: aitab meeskondadel koostada PRD-sid, vaadata koodi üle, võtta logid kokku ja planeerida samm-sammult agentide töövooge koostöös – kasulik, kui sa kujundad rolliviipasid, kontrollnimekirju ja hindamisrubriike enne rakendamist. Uurige Siderit aadressil
Kokkuvõte
- Vali OpenAGI, kui sa soovid paindlikku, komponeeritavat raamistikku, et luua eritellimusel valmistatud agentide torujuhtmeid, millel on sügav kontroll tööriistade, mälu ja planeerimise üle.
- Vali MetaGPT, kui sa soovid tõestatud, rollipõhist mitme agendi süsteemi, et tarkvara kiiremini tarnida mõistlike vaikesätetega spetsifikatsioonide, disaini, kodeerimise ja kvaliteedikontrolli jaoks.
Mõlemad on õiged – lihtsalt mitte samade tööde jaoks.
Peamised järeldused
- OpenAGI = paindlikkus ja kontroll; MetaGPT = struktuur ja kiirus.
- Agentide kohustuslikud asjad 2025. aastal: planeerimine, tööriistad, mälu, hindamine ja jälgitavus.
- Alusta lõpust: määratle väljundid, mõõdikud ja ülevaatusväravad. Seejärel vali raamistik, mis viib sind sinna kõige vähesema hõõrdumisega.
KKK